Is Your Flame Failure Protection Really Reliable? Find Out!



Is your flame failure protection really reliable? This question often lingers in the minds of many users who depend on heating systems for comfort. I understand the frustration that comes with worrying about safety while trying to enjoy a warm environment.

Many people experience anxiety over potential hazards, especially when it comes to gas appliances. The fear of a flame failure, which can lead to dangerous gas leaks, is a valid concern. So, how can we ensure that the flame failure protection in our systems is up to the mark?

First, let’s look at the components involved in flame failure protection. These systems typically include a flame sensor and a safety valve. The flame sensor detects the presence of a flame, while the safety valve shuts off the gas supply if the flame goes out.

To evaluate the reliability of your flame failure protection, consider these steps:

  1. Regular Maintenance: Schedule routine inspections with a qualified technician. They can clean the flame sensor and ensure that all components are functioning correctly.

  2. Test the System: Periodically test the flame failure protection by turning on the appliance and observing if it shuts off the gas supply when the flame is extinguished.

  3. Check for Faulty Components: If you notice any irregularities, such as the flame flickering or the appliance shutting off unexpectedly, it might indicate a problem with the flame sensor or safety valve.

  4. User Manual Review: Familiarize yourself with the user manual of your heating system. It often contains valuable information about the flame failure protection features specific to your model.

  5. Stay Informed: Keep up with any recalls or safety notices related to your appliance. Manufacturers sometimes issue updates that can enhance safety.

In conclusion, ensuring that your flame failure protection is reliable requires a proactive approach. Regular maintenance, testing, and staying informed can significantly reduce risks. By taking these steps, you can enjoy peace of mind, knowing that your heating system is equipped to keep you safe.

The Truth About Flame Failure Protection: Are You Safe?


Flame failure protection is a critical safety feature that many people may overlook. I often hear concerns about gas appliances and their potential hazards. The truth is, understanding flame failure protection is essential for ensuring your safety at home.

When a gas appliance operates, it relies on a flame to ignite the gas. If this flame goes out unexpectedly, unburned gas can accumulate, leading to dangerous situations. This is where flame failure protection comes into play. It acts as a safeguard, automatically shutting off the gas supply if the flame is extinguished.

Many users may not realize how often this feature works behind the scenes. For instance, I recently spoke with a homeowner who experienced a gas stove flame going out while cooking. Thanks to the flame failure protection, the gas supply was cut off immediately, preventing a potentially hazardous situation. This real-life scenario highlights the importance of having reliable safety features in our appliances.

To ensure your appliances are equipped with flame failure protection, here are a few steps you can take:

  1. Check the Specifications: When purchasing a gas appliance, look for specifications that mention flame failure protection. This feature should be clearly stated.

  2. Regular Maintenance: Schedule regular maintenance checks for your appliances. A qualified technician can ensure that the flame failure protection system is functioning correctly.

  3. Educate Yourself: Familiarize yourself with how your gas appliances work. Understanding the safety features can give you peace of mind.

  4. Install Carbon Monoxide Detectors: While flame failure protection is vital, installing carbon monoxide detectors adds an extra layer of safety. These detectors can alert you to any gas leaks that may occur.

In summary, flame failure protection is a crucial aspect of gas appliance safety. By being informed and proactive, you can significantly reduce risks in your home. Remember, safety starts with knowledge and the right precautions.
